Output 853a3812affda18605bf877815cdcb510368bf9ff9f24770d29b1381969435d0:12

value
11309045
script pubkey
OP_0 OP_PUSHBYTES_20 aa7518dfba8f2ea0408838320a2f5d06b9c8205d
address
ltc1q4f633ha63uh2qsyg8qeq5t6aq6uusgzajj4g3y
transaction
853a3812affda18605bf877815cdcb510368bf9ff9f24770d29b1381969435d0
spent
true